Become Involved

There are four ways that you can become involved with the Ridge House Museum:

• Volunteer
• Membership

• Sponsorship
• Bequests

For more information about how to become involved with the Ridge House Museum, please contact the Curator at 519.674.2223 or CKridgehouse@chatham-kent.ca

Volunteer
We offer a wide variety of volunteer possibilities:

• Assisting with programs
• Guiding tours
• Baking
• Assisting with exhibits

For more information or to become a volunteer, please contact the Curator at 519.674.2223.

Back to Top


Membership
Memberships to the Ridge House Museum are available for Free, as well as $20, $50, and $100 levels.  For more information, call the Box Office at (519) 354-8338, or click on the "CCC Membership Brochure" download to the right.

• Discounts
Members receive a special rate on almost all programs, classes, and special events presented by the Ridge House Museum.

• Invitations
Members receive a special invitation to all Ridge House Museum events.

• A Good Feeling
Your membership shows your commitment and concern for heritage in this community in a tangible way. It's a good feeling to know you've contributed.

Back to Top


Sponsorship
We have a variety of ways in which individuals, community groups and businesses may help support the museum. You could:

• Sponsor an education program
• Sponsor a special event
• Help restore an artifact
• Help purchase an artifact
• Sponsor an exhibit in our gallery
